Villeneuve criticises Verstappen: 'He has thrown away the pole'

Jacques Villeneuve saw Max Verstappen impress on Saturday during the difficult circumstances during the Grand Prix weekend in Turkey. However, at the decisive moment the 23-year-old Dutchman failed to take pole position and that is to blame, according to the Formula 1 analyst. A first place would have been possible if Verstappen had been less 'aggressive' in the closing stages. Villeneueve emphasises that Verstappen was two seconds faster than the competition at Istanbul Park. "So he could easily take pole," said the single world champion, who saw the Red Bull Racing driver switch to the intermediates at the wrong time.
